Realistic Expectations: Outcomes and Limitations
Complying with refractive surgical procedure, it is very important to recognize what you can realistically anticipate regarding your vision end results. Numerous clients achieve 20/25 vision or better, but perfect eyesight isn't assured. Some may still require glasses for details tasks, like reading or driving at night.
It's important to have realistic expectations about the potential for small vision changes during the healing process.
In addition, numerous aspects such as age, pre-existing problems, and the sort of surgical treatment can affect your outcomes. While difficulties are unusual, they can occur, so discussing these risks with your doctor is crucial.
